    摘要:

    回顧了我國天氣雷達從常規雷達發展到單極化多普勒, 再到雙極化多普勒,雷達獲取目標的參數信息更加豐富的過程。分析了常規、單極化多普勒、雙極化多普勒雷達工作原理及其產品信息。對于我國新一代S、C和X波段的天氣雷達性能進行了研究對比。闡述了毫米波段多普勒測云雷達工作原理及其產品。對新一代天氣雷達網進行了分析及展望,雙極化將是我國天氣雷達網升級改造趨勢,為彌補新一代天氣雷達探測盲區,小型移動電掃描雷達也是一種輔助主雷達網可移動靈活布網的趨勢。

    Abstract:

    With the development of radar technology across the world, the domestic radar has developed from conventional radar to single polarization Doppler, then double polarization Doppler, with the target information obtained being more abundant. The principles and product information of conventional radar, single polarization Doppler, and double polarization Doppler radar are introduced in detail. The performances of the next generation S , C , and X band radar are compared, which has a certain reference value for the selection of the radar wavelength. The millimeter wave Doppler radar is also introduced, which can obtain cloud structure information. The performance and trends of the next generation radar network are evaluated. The double polarization Doppler radar will be the main trend; the electronic scanning small mobile radar will also become important for its flexibility, to make up the blind spots of next generation weather radar sounding.
